Flight Rights in the Snow

Following major disruption to many of the transport networks recently, Espe Fuentes, lawyer at Which? Legal Service offers the following advice to anyone due to travel from any of the UK’s airports.

"If you are unfortunate enough to have had your flight delayed or cancelled because of the bad weather you are covered by EU regluations. If your flight has been delayed you are entitled to assistance in the way of meals and refreshments, 2 phone calls and overnight accomodation of applicable. If your flight is cancelled the EU regulations require an airline to offer you either a full refund or an alternative flight to your destination as soon as one is avaliable. As well as this you are entitled to refreshments and meals the amount of this depends on the delay and how long you are at the airport."
